What is a paperback print cover design?

Many authors love the feeling of holding their books physically in their hands. A paperback print cover is a designed file that you can upload to print-on-demand platforms like Amazon's KDP Print or IngramSpark. Paperback refers to the type of printing. A paperback does not have a hardcover or dustjacket.

What are the specifications of the print-ready paperback file?

  • File Type: PDF
  • File Size: <50MB
  • Dimensions: Trim size (e.g. 5x8) will be specified by author/publisher. The final page count will determine how thick the spine is. Please note that we can not accommodate text on the spine for any book with less than 100 pages.
  • Colour Profile: CMYK
  • Resolution: 300 DPI
